In Kuwait city, there are a number of large roundabout intersections where they wanted to gather traffic statistical data for a set period of time. They wanted to collect the following data types:
- Traffic volumes
- Classification
- Turning movements
- U-turn movements
- Journey time
- Congestion areas
This information was gathered and later used for optimizing traffic lights and determining road development infrastructure.
The RTMS Sx-300 sensor was used to deliver statistical data with a high accuracy of around 95% and relevant floating car information using the integrated Bluetooth sensor. In addition to the Sx-300 sensors, DeepBlue Bluetooth sensors were positioned at different points of interest around the roundabout to collect data on U-turn movements. This information is collected by a customizable software that runs algorithms to determine this information.
The Bluetooth device detects the MAC address of the activated Bluetooth device in a car and that information is sent to the DeepBlue Core software, where sophisticated algorithms process the data and provide a graphical representation of the data. By having the RTMS Sx-300 coupled with additional Bluetooth sensors, the point data like presence data and spatial data like turning movements and origin destination information are collected into one system and provide a complete picture of your traffic.
The city of Kuwait was able to get a better understanding of the traffic flow which allowed them to optimize the existing roadways.
